Detailed vulnerability description
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to cause DoS condition on the target system.
The weakness exists in the kernel mode layer helper function due to incorrect detection and recovery from an invalid state. A remote attacker can perform specific actions and cause the system to crash.
Successful exploitation of the vulnerability results in denial of service.

How to mitigate CVE-2017-6259
Update GeForce to version 384.94.
Update Quadro, NVS and Tesla to version 377.55, 385.08.
